thatch
noun
/θætʃ/

Definition
Thatch refers to a layer of plant material, such as straw, palm leaves, or reeds, used for roofing a building.

Examples
- The cottage was beautifully covered with a thick thatch.
- In some cultures, thatch roofing is common due to its natural availability.
- Thatch can help keep homes cooler in the summer and warmer in the winter.

Meaning
A traditional roofing material that provides insulation and protection from the elements.
